My informant Cetin told me this in an interview for the research about four “drawn stories” that are published in the weekly comic magazines Uykusuz and Penguen in Turkey.2 These drawn stories are called “Sandik Ici” (Inside the

Chest), “Genco’nun Yalan Dunyasi” (Genco’s Fake World), “Ortam: Dunyanin En Telmasa Adami” (Ortam: The Most Nugatory Man of the World), and Otisabi (“Big Brother Otis”). These are different stories of four male protagonists: Ersin, Genco, Ortam, and Otis. In this chapter, I will illustrate who these fictional men are, where they live, with whom they interact, and what they represent in terms of subjectivity through popular culture.
